很多不太懂正则的朋友,在遇到需要用正则校验数据时,往往是在网上去找很久,结果找来的还是不很符合要求。所以我最近把开发中常用的一些正则表达式整理了一下,包括校验数字、字符、一些特殊的需求等等。给自己留个底,也给朋友们做个参考。1校验数字的表达式数字:^[0-9]*$n位的数字:^\d{n}$至少n位的数字:^\d{n,}$m-n位的数字:^\d{m,n}$零和非零开头的数字:^(0|[1-9][0-
## 校验Java中的MAC地址格式
在Java编程中,有时候我们需要对输入的MAC地址进行格式校验,以确保其符合规范。MAC地址是网络设备的唯一标识符,通常由六组十六进制数字组成,用冒号或者破折号隔开。正确的MAC地址格式类似于 `00:1A:2B:3C:4D:5E` 或者 `00-1A-2B-3C-4D-5E`。
在本文中,我们将介绍如何使用正则表达式来校验Java中的MAC地址格式,并提
原创
2024-03-13 05:40:31
234阅读
# 在 Android 应用中实现邮箱格式的正则判断
作为一名刚入行的开发者,遭遇数据验证问题是一个常见的挑战。本篇文章将带你逐步实现 Android 邮箱格式的正则判断。通过明确的流程、详细的代码实现以及清晰的注释,逐步引导你掌握这一技能。
## 整体流程
在实现邮箱格式正则判断的过程中,我们可以将整个流程拆分为以下几步:
| 步骤 | 描述 |
|------|------|
| 步骤
一些题外话= =这学期选了了一门安卓的课。 对于AS环境搭建的繁杂性早有耳闻。 虽然老师开了答疑课 btw 只是针对Windows系统的同学 没关系! Mac同学自力更生hhh现有的帖子无法满足新版本的安装问题 有些解决问题的方法已经不再适用 历经了两天两夜(划掉)的踩坑体验 终于运行了第一个HelloWorld程序 写一篇帖子记录一下 作为我万一哪天需要重装该神仙软件的备忘录 //(当然最好是不
转载
2023-09-08 22:27:00
100阅读
正则表达式是处理字符串的强大工具,它有自己特定的语法结构,有了它,实现字符串的检索、替换、匹配验证都不在话下。当然,对于爬虫来说,有了它,从 HTML 里提取想要的信息就非常方便了。在这里我们着重讲解一下通用匹配 .*复杂的例子:import re
content = 'Hello 123 4567 World_This is a Regex Demo'
result = re.match('^H
转载
2024-09-24 12:08:15
45阅读
# 如何在Mac上使用Android Studio进行代码格式化
## 一、流程
首先,我们来看一下整个流程的步骤,可以用下面的表格展示: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 打开Android Studio |
| 2 | 点击菜单栏中的"Code" |
| 3 | 选择"Reformat Code" |
| 4 | 勾选相应的格式化选项 |
| 5 | 点
原创
2024-03-19 06:17:59
80阅读
# Android Mac格式化代码
在开发Android应用程序的过程中,我们经常需要编写大量的代码。为了提高代码的可读性和维护性,我们通常会对代码进行格式化处理。在Mac上,我们可以使用一些工具来帮助我们格式化代码,使其符合统一的代码风格。
## Android Studio
Android Studio是官方推荐的Android开发工具,提供了丰富的功能来帮助开发者编写和调试Andro
原创
2024-06-17 04:29:35
75阅读
该如何在Mac上格式化U盘或转换USB格式为FAT32?你好,我有一个64GB的U盘,里面储存了20GB的文件。而我计算机上的一些程序只接受FAT32文件系统才能将文件保存到外接式储存设备。我想把这些资料保存到U盘中,那就有个问题了,就是我必须先格式化或转换U盘格式。如何在Mac计算机上格式化或将U盘转换为FAT32?有谁知道这个问题的解决办法吗?网络上提供大多数「在Mac计算机上格式化USB随身
转载
2024-07-23 20:03:08
30阅读
# Java IP地址格式和MAC地址格式正则表达式
在Java中,我们经常需要对IP地址和MAC地址进行验证。IP地址通常用于网络通信,而MAC地址是用于标识网络设备的唯一地址。为了方便验证这些地址的格式是否正确,我们可以使用正则表达式来实现。
## IP地址格式验证
IP地址是一个32位的二进制数,通常用点分十进制表示。一个合法的IPv4地址由四个十进制数组成,每个数组范围在0到255之
原创
2024-05-21 06:26:39
75阅读
随着使用苹果产品的人逐渐增多,继而接触Mac系统的人也变多了。与Windows系统不同的是,Mac系统拥有一套自己的算法。在很多操作方面都与Windows系统不太一样。例如,磁盘格式转换问题,在Mac上想要进行操作,就需要用到第三方磁盘工具。通常而言,我们使用的磁盘格式包括以下这几种,FAT16、FAT32、NTFS以及新格式exFAT。FAT格式基本上使用的人已经变少,目前较为流行的是NTFS格
转载
2023-12-04 15:45:57
63阅读
# 在Mac上使用Python的正则表达式
正则表达式(Regular Expressions,简称Regex)是一种强大的文本处理工具,允许用户通过模式匹配来提取和替换文本。在Mac环境下,Python的`re`模块为我们提供了使用正则表达式的能力。这篇文章将详细介绍正则表达式的基本概念,并通过示例展示如何在Python中使用它,尤其是在Mac操作系统上。
## 1. 正则表达式的基本概念
原创
2024-10-02 05:17:15
19阅读
## 实现Java正则表达式匹配Mac地址
### 1. 概述
在Java中,我们可以使用正则表达式来匹配和验证Mac地址。Mac地址是网络设备的唯一标识符,它由六组由冒号或连字符分隔的十六进制数字组成。在本篇文章中,我将向你介绍如何使用Java正则表达式来匹配Mac地址。
### 2. 实现步骤
以下是实现这个任务的步骤列表:
| 步骤 | 描述 |
| --- | --- |
| 1
原创
2023-12-04 08:22:39
103阅读
一、Permute它用于格式转换,包括视频、音频,图片乃至pdf,不仅效率高,而且完美配合downie、iTunes,浑然一体,极其舒适 二、Downie既然提到Permute就不得不提Downie,它支持1000+网站视频下载,包括YouTube、B站等,而且可以设置4K分辨率下载,几乎无所不能,绝对的神器,老司机必备 三、OnyX很多人都吹CleanMyMac、Dr.Cle
转载
2024-02-07 13:17:04
4阅读
# Android Studio 单行格式化(Mac)教程
## 简介
在Android开发过程中,我们经常需要对代码进行格式化以提高可读性和维护性。本教程将指导你如何在Mac上使用Android Studio进行单行代码格式化。
## 流程
以下是实现"Android Studio 单行格式化(Mac)"的步骤:
| 步骤 | 描述 |
| -------- | --------- |
|
原创
2023-12-30 05:14:43
37阅读
## 实现Mac Android Studio格式化代码的步骤
为了帮助刚入行的小白实现在Mac上使用Android Studio格式化代码,我将提供以下步骤和相应的代码示例。
### 步骤1:打开Android Studio
首先,你需要打开Android Studio,并打开你的项目。
### 步骤2:找到"Preferences"选项
在Mac上,你可以通过点击菜单栏上的"Andr
原创
2023-07-15 18:00:47
497阅读
# Mac Android Studio设置格式化
作为经验丰富的开发者,你肯定知道在Android开发中保持代码的格式一致性是非常重要的。Android Studio提供了一些设置来自动格式化代码,使其看起来更加整洁和易读。对于刚入行的小白,下面是一份关于如何在Mac上设置Android Studio代码格式化的指南。
## 整体流程
首先,我们来整理一下这个过程的整体流程,如下图所示:
原创
2024-01-07 08:02:30
115阅读
public class DateCheck
{
/**
* 正则表达式验证日期格式
* @param args
*/
public static void main(String[] args)
{
String checkValue = "2007-02-29";
转载
2023-07-26 17:14:11
127阅读
## Java生成MAC正则表达式
在Java开发中,我们经常需要对MAC地址进行验证或者生成正则表达式。MAC地址是网卡设备的唯一标识符,由12位十六进制数组成,用冒号或者连字符分割。
本文将介绍如何使用Java生成MAC地址的正则表达式,并提供具体实例代码。
### 生成MAC正则表达式
首先,我们需要了解MAC地址的格式。MAC地址由6个字节组成,每个字节使用两个十六进制数表示,共1
原创
2023-12-13 08:04:23
33阅读
# 使用 Java 正则表达式判断 MAC 地址
在计算机网络中,MAC 地址(媒体访问控制地址)是网络接口的唯一标识。它通常由六组十六进制数(0-9,A-F)组成,每组用一个冒号或短横线分隔。正则表达式(Regex)是处理字符串的强大工具,我们可以用它来判断一个字符串是否符合 MAC 地址的格式。
## 什么是正则表达式?
正则表达式是一种文本模式,用于描述一组字符串的共同特征。它能够帮助
原创
2024-10-26 04:04:11
40阅读
目录一、正则表达式的困境二、书写正确的表达式三、如何让表达式更优雅四、正则表达式的“回溯陷阱”总结 一、正则表达式的困境如果你对正则表达式的基本用法还不了解,请先移步正则表达式(基础篇)。现在我假设你已经掌握了正则表达式的基本语法,也许你已经迫不及待想找个题目练练手,下面就有一个非常简单的题目:请书写一个能匹配标准IPV4地址的正则表达式。什么是一个标准的IPV4地址呢?其实描述起来非常简单,就